Overview of Virginia (VDOT) Practices for New Materials  New Products Application – the VDOT new products application may be accessed at the following website: http://www.virginiadot.org/business/resources/bu-mat- NewProdApp.pdf  New Products Committee  Special Products Evaluation List (SPEL)  Approved Lists  Virginia Transportation Research Council (VTRC) implementation program - moving a research recommendation or innovative new technology, concept, material, or process and incorporating it into VDOT’s accepted practice  Example of innovation deployment in Virginia – discussions with vendor at AASHTO meetings, trial installation of product, evaluation of product performance, inclusion of product on SPEL, development of standard specification 2

FHWA Bridge Preservation Expert Task Group (BPETG) - Advancing Innovation in the area of Bridge Preservation The BPETG has identified issues related to advancing innovation in the area of bridge preservation as related to approval of new and existing products and treatments. The BPETG conducted two surveys. The findings of these two surveys include:  Lack of consistency in the evaluation, testing, and approval processes. For example, a product manufacturer goes through various processes with each state DOT in order to have a product placed on the approved list for the same product or treatment  Lack of national or regional specifications. Product/treatment specifications vary by state for using the same product or treatment 3  There is national consensus on the need to improve current processes

FHWA Bridge Preservation Expert Task Group (BPETG) - Advancing Innovation in the area of Bridge Preservation The BPETG recommends establishing a task force of representatives from AASHTO subcommittees to:  Develop recommendations to AASHTO that standardize the requirements and processes for products and treatments approval and implementation for adoption on national and or regional basis.  Identify a few commonly used bridge preservation products/treatments and develop specifications for these products/treatments that can be adopted by AASHTO nationally and/or regionally by State DOTs. 4
